Pudding sauce contains 110 calories per 100 g. A 100 g serving also provides 20 g of carbohydrates, 2.5 g of protein, and 2.5 g of fat.
Yes, pudding sauce is compatible with vegetarian, flexitarian, and omnivore diets. It contains dairy, so it is not suitable for people with dairy allergies.
